Gasification. Gasification is the process of converting waste into a gaseous product (called syngas) by exposure to high temperatures in the presence of oxygen or steam. Syngas is primarily composed of carbon dioxide, hydrogen and carbon monoxide and can be burned as fuel or further refined to a liquid fuel.

Edmonton Waste Management Centre •Waste-to-Biofuels Facility •MSW processed to “refuse-derived fuel” quality •haiqi - 100,000 tonnes/year RDF fed to gasification system •RDF converted to syngas •Syngas cleaned and converted to 36 million litres/year of alcohols

OE Gasification is a company based in Waterloo, Canada, which provides small-scale gasification systems. Each module can accept between 3500–7500 tonnes of waste per year with a thermal output of 1.5–2.5 MWt. These systems can be stacked in order to accommodate varying amounts of throughput.

Oct 20, 2011 · Effective use of this available waste biomass would improve Canada’s ability to reduce toxic air emissions, greenhouse gas, and its dependence on oil while supporting agriculture and rural economies. One way of converting biomass to energy is gasification, a thermo-chemical process.
